Where Do I Stand

Suzanne Mondoux · 11 October 2020

Song/Poem of the Year

And there in lies the evil of all this believing in something bigger than yourself Follow your conscious Follow your instincts And really, who’s the puppet Who’s really controlling the strings And all this time you thought it was you Well, I’m the biggest fool of them all for believing otherwise Now where do I stand in all this mess It’s a mess alright Where do I stand on the curve of my own pendulum I’ve swung so far one way and just as far the other I’ve put my faith into it all, especially myself And woops I find myself right back where I began So is this where I stand Always at the start line with just a few more belongings But really nothing gained Where do I stand amongst all those around me They seem happy, but they don’t What did I miss What did I do wrong to end up in my pile of shit It all looks good on the outside But you wouldn’t dare peek inside You won’t like what you find I assure you You don’t want to be where I’m standing What I’m looking at The constant pounding The constant planning to end it The constant disbelieving all dreams Even the ones lived So where do I stand With me, or with reality
